Tips on Grooming Your Pet for family pet Owners in Senatobia MS




Routine grooming with a brush or comb will really help keep your family pet’s hair in excellent shape by removing dirt, spreading out natural oils across her coat, preventing tangles and keeping her skin clean and irritant-free.

Plus, brushing time is a great time to look for fleas and flea dirt– those little black specks that show your family pet is playing host to a flea household.

Learn more about, brushing you dogs or check out below.

The way you brush your fur baby and how regularly will mostly depend on his/her coat type.

Smooth, Short Coats: If your pet dog has a smooth, brief coat (like that of a Chihuahua, Boxer or Basset Hound), you only need to brush once a week. Utilize a rubber brush to loosen dead skin and dirt and follow with bristle brush to remove dead hair. Polish your low-maintenance pooch with a chamois cloth and she’s ready to shine!

Brief, Thick Fur: If your pet dog has short, dense fur that’s vulnerable to matting, like that of a retriever, brushing as soon as a week is great. Make use of a slicker brush to remove tangles and pluck dead hair with a bristle brush. Don’t forget to comb her tail!

Long, Silky Coats: If your canine has a long, luxurious coat, like that of a Yorkshire terrier, she’ll need day-to-day looking after. Every day you’ll require to eliminate tangles with a slicker brush. Next, brush her coat with a bristle brush. If you have a long-haired dog with a coat like a collie’s or an Afghan hound’s, follow the steps above, however also be sure to comb through the fur and trim the hair around the feet.

Long Hair That’s Often Matted: For long-haired pooches, it’s a great idea to establish a day-to-day grooming routine to eliminate tangles and prevent mats. Gently tease out tangles with a slicker brush, and after that brush your fur baby with a bristle brush. If matting is particularly dense, you may attempt clipping the hair, taking care not to come near the skin.

Causes of skin problems on dogs – One of the following can cause an anomaly of your skin and a veterinarian must inspect it.

  • Fleas – Bites and droppings from these bothersome insects can aggravate your pet’s skin, and some dogs may get an allergy to the saliva after a bite. Some pet dogs might also dislike flea-treatment items; for instance, certain flea collars might trigger soreness and inflammation around the neck.
  • Ringworm – A greatly contagious fungal infection, flaky patches and hair loss can ensue. You will want to treat it quickly to avoid infection of other animals and people in the home.



  • Seasonal or food allergies – Your fur baby’s scratching might be triggered by her intolerance to irritants found in everyday products such as pollen, weeds, dust, mites, trees, mold or lawns. In the winter season, lots of pet dogs, like individuals, develop dry, flaky skin. Some pets get allergies to popular pet dog food elements consisting of beef, chicken, wheat, corn, or soy. Fillers and colorings can also be viewed as alien by your pet’s body immune system, leading to irritation and rashes.
  • Skin infections – Dogs may get unpleasant infections of the germs or yeast when skin is affected by another skin disease./li>
  • Sarcoptic mange – This skin condition triggered by sarcoptic scabei mite infestation leads in serious itching and swelling of the skin, similar to an allergic reaction.
  • Grooming products – Some hair shampoos and toiletries might aggravate the skin of your canine. Ensure you only utilize toiletries meant for animals.
  • Stress or boredom –For many causes, a pet can lick his skin too much (especially his legs). Some pet dogs lick when the exercise or mental stimulation is not adequate.
  • Metabolic or hormonal problems –A variety of typical hormonal issues can result in modifications in skin colour, coat consistency, thickness, and circulation.

    Picking Toothpaste for Pet Dogs

    Do not utilize human tooth paste, which can irritate a dog’s stomach. Rather, ask your vet for toothpaste made especially for dogs or make a paste out of baking soda and water.




    Tips on Eye Care for Pet Owners in Senatobia MS

    Did you know that you can provide frequent eye care for your pet dog in your home? Regular home eye exams will guarantee you’re mindful of any eye tearing, cloudiness, health issues, and swelling.

    Initially, get your canine to sit and face a brightly lit area when examining their eyes. If healthy, they should be lit and clear, and the surrounding location to the eyeball should be white. The pupils ought to be equally sized and there must not be any signs of tearing, crust, or discharge on the corners of their eyes.

    To get rid of any substance in their eyes, use a mild wipe and a wet cotton ball. Carefully clean in the external direction from the edge of their eyes and make sure you do not touch their eyeball. Its best you seek medical attention from your neighborhood Senatobia veterinarian as they may have an infection if your family pet routinely has actually runny eyes triggered from discharge.

    Identifying an Ear Infection in Pet Dogs

    It can be hard for caught up debris or water inside a pet’s ear to be released, making it rather easy for pet dogs to get ear infections. Ensure you are routinely checking your pet’s ears for smell, swelling, discharge or any other indications of infection. If your pet dog has any of the symptoms shown below, visit your veterinarian as soon as you can.

    • Ear scratching
    • Ear swelling
    • Ear smell
    • Discharge that is brown, yellow or bloody
    • Crusted or scabby skin surrounding the ear flap
    • Loss of hair around the ear
    • Soreness surrounding ear
    • Vertigo
    • Loss of hearing
    • Cleaning their ear on the ground
    • Unusual head shaking or head tilt
    • Walking in circles




    Finding Nail Clippers for Your Pet Dogs

    There are normally two types of nail clippers for canines: scissors or guillotine. They work equally well, so simply go with the style that you feel more comfortable using and dealing with.

    If your pet is not comfortable with either clipper types, another tool is the nail mill. It is an electrical tool that effectively sands down pet nails. They offer good control however take longer than routine clippers and some pets might discover the vibration sounds to be undesirable or scary.     Treating Wounds in Dogs

    It’s fairly common for dogs to get cuts or injuries from mistakenly trotting on particles, glass, or other foreign objects. Small injuries under half an inch can be cleaned up with anti-bacterial wash and then covered with a light plaster. Whilst much deeper cuts may require veterinary care.
